Key Document Types Requiring Notarised Translations for UK Immigration
When embarking on the immigration process within the UK, individuals often encounter a multitude of documentation requirements that necessitate precise and officially recognised translations. Notarised translation services in the UK play a pivotal role in this context, ensuring that official documents are accurately conveyed in both English and the source language. Key among these document types are passports and identity documents, which are critical for verifying an individual’s identity as part of the immigration application. Additionally, educational certificates and transcripts require notarisation to demonstrate the authenticity of academic qualifications to UK institutions. Other essential documents that typically need to be translated and notarised include birth, marriage, and death certificates, which are often required to establish family ties or dependent relationships for visa purposes. Medical records may also be necessary, particularly if health history is relevant to the immigration process. Legal documents such as contracts, wills, and court orders must be notarised to ensure they are legally binding in the UK. Navigating Legal Requirements: The Process of Notarising Translations in the UK
Navigating the legal requirements for immigration in the UK often necessitates the provision of documents in English, which can require certified translations alongside notarisation to ensure their authenticity and legal acceptance. Notarised translation services UK play a pivotal role in this process by offering precise and authoritative translations that meet the stringent standards required for official use. These services are delivered by professionals who are adept at converting legal documents from one language to another while adhering to UK regulations. The notarisation process involves a notary public verifying the identity of the document’s translator and confirming that the translation is accurate and complete. This dual process of translation and notarisation ensures that the documents will be accepted by UK immigration authorities, thus facilitating a smoother and more secure immigration process for individuals entering the country.
Furthermore, when seeking notarised translation services UK, it is imperative to engage with organisations that are accredited and recognised by both the UK Notaries Public Association and the relevant foreign embassies or consulates. These translations must carry the notary’s seal and stamp, along with their signature, to validate the document’s authenticity. Choosing a Reputable Notarised Translation Service Provider in the UK
When navigating the complexities of immigration in the UK, having your documents accurately translated and notarised is paramount. A trusted notarised translation service provider in the UK offers peace of mind by ensuring that all translations meet the stringent requirements set forth by UK authorities. These providers are adept at handling a wide array of languages and document types, from passports to birth certificates, with precision and compliance with legal standards. It’s crucial to choose a service that is accredited by professional translation bodies such as the Institute of Translation and Interpreting (ITI) or the Association of Translation Companies (ATC). This accreditation assures clients that the translators are qualified, the translations are accurate, and the notarisation process adheres to UK legal frameworks. Additionally, a reputable service will provide certified translations, which include a statement of accuracy and a notarial certificate confirming the translator’s identity and qualifications.
